Academic Registrar’s Office

The Office of the Registrar provides an academic experience and enrollment services in support of 91黑料鈥檚 diverse academic community. We coordinate services in the areas of student registration, course enrolment, timetabling, examination, graduation, convocation, data protection and release of academic records.

The divisions under the purview of the Registrar鈥檚 Office include Registration Unit (RU), Examination and Records Unit (ERU) and Bursary Unit (BU).

Registration Unit (RU)

The Registration Unit implements operational policies and procedures. It focuses on the facilitation of the enrolment of new students, the creation of student records, as well as the management of the advancement of students from the Foundation and Diploma studies into their respective Bachelor programmes. The RU also coordinates requests for change of study, as well as the deferment of student admission.

Examination and Records Unit (ERU)

There are several main functions of the ERU. The first is to formulate and propose the annual MMU Academic Calendar, while the second is to coordinate and manage the course enrolment processes. Other functions include the upkeep of student records both digitally or physically, the coordination of examination processes in accordance with the university’s rules and regulations, and overseeing the graduation of students. Furthermore, the ERU serves as the custodian for all credit-bearing academic records for current and former MMU students.

Bursary Unit (BU)

The Bursary Unit is responsible for the facilitation of financial aid for MMU students. As such, the unit will guide and assist MMU students in applying for various types of financial aid, such as scholarships and study loans. On top of that, the Bursary Unit also liaises, on behalf of MMU students, with agencies and companies providing said aid.
